AMC is to open a 16-screen multiplex at the Great Northern leisure and shopping development in Manchester this month. The £100m, 10-acre new complex, which is set to fully open next Spring, already has a number of developments up and running including a Virgin Active Pure Fitness club, a PerSia restaurant, History Expresso and a Bar 38. Joint developers Morrison Merlin Ltd has created an open-air amphitheatre, an 18,000sq ft atrium and transformed a Victorian railway goods warehouse into 70,000sq ft of leisure and retail space. Shoeless Joe's is due to open its first bar/club/restaurant concept outside of London at the development early next year, and Hilton International will start work on a 4-star hotel opposite the site next spring.
